While the people here are very nice, I do NOT recommend getting a loan from CECU. I purchased a vehicle, after having extensive conversations with my loan officer, and she ensured me that we were all good to go and to call her when the sale was made, and the credit union was open. When I gave her the details of my purchase, she informed me that CECU could NOT in fact cover the entire amount of my purchase with my auto loan, since the Blue Book value estimated the car to be worth less than I had paid. This had NEVER come up in conversation before, and the CARFAX report indicated that my purchase was a good deal. I had no idea that I needed to compare the purchase price to the Blue Book value in order to get the full amount covered, and I am now not only feeling completely taken advantage of by the dealership, but also by the credit union. I had to take out a second line of credit with a significantly higher interest rate to cover the remainder of the amount and am now paying more than I had budgeted for. Again, I had multiple conversations with my loan officer and was never warned that this could be the case. DO NOT RECOMMEND.
